    As Mike posted, most of the bedsides were cut off and the bedsides mounted over what was left. I’d previously cut out a huge section on each side to stop “cutting” the outside of tires each time they stuffed while rotating. But we preserved the top rails (to better support the bedrack) and the section surrounding the tail lights (so we could use the existing mounting points. I learned after observing @831Tun on a fast trail. :boink:) You can see in the pic that the interior edge of the tire still rubs inside the well. Never done....
